In this episode of Social Sleuth, I am joined by Chris Hurl & Kevin Walby, two of the four authors of “Mobilizing Data for Justice: A Guide to Activism in the Digital Age”. Published with Between the Lines, Chris, Kevin, Elena Rowan, and Marius Senneville seek to offer a toolbox for mobilizing data for justice - rooted in activist experiences and knowledge.
Chris and Kevin each showcase their unique perspectives and knowledge over the range of dynamics within social movements and mobilizing in the digital age - exploring how social movements utilize data and techniques such as visceralization to fight for justice, navigate surveillance, and build collective power. Each underscoring their role in bringing these existing experiences, dilemmas, and solutions, together - to serve future social movement communities and act as an archive as the digital context rapidly evolves.
